Icebreaker Toolkit: Simple Openers That Start Real Conversations

Feeling unsure what to say is normal. Turn that worry into a few easy patterns you can adapt to any profile so messages feel natural, not rehearsed.

Opener Patterns To Try

  • Profile hook + curiosity: “I noticed you hike—what’s one trail you’d recommend to someone who’s only done easy routes?”
  • Small choice question: “Coffee or tea for a lazy Sunday—and what’s your go-to order?”
  • Shared detail callback: “You mentioned a stray bookstore photo—what’s the last book you bought?”
  • Playful observation: “That dog in your pic looks like it judges my playlist. What song would it hate?”
  • Low-pressure invitation to share: “I’m collecting terrible pizza toppings. What’s one you secretly like?”

How To Make Openers Feel Personal

  • Pick one specific detail from their profile or photos. Mentioning it shows you read, but keep it light—no deep probing on first message.
  • Ask a question that’s easy to answer in a sentence or two. Avoid yes/no traps and anything overly intense like future plans or relationship history.
  • Keep tone consistent with their profile: mirror their humor or casualness, but don’t mimic exact phrases.

What To Avoid

  • Generic lines: Skip “Hey” or “What’s up?”—they rarely invite a real reply.
  • Forced compliments: Compliment something specific and not just looks (e.g., creativity in their photos, a unique hobby).
  • Overly personal or heavy questions: Save deep topics for later conversations once rapport is built.
  • Copy-paste openers: If you use a pattern, tweak one or two words so it matches the person you’re messaging.

Quick Templates You Can Personalize

  1. “I see you love [hobby]—what got you into it?”
  2. “That picture at [place type] looks fun. What was the best part of that day?”
  3. “Tough but important: pancakes or waffles? Explain your choice.”

Keep first messages short, curious, and easy to answer. Small, specific details and friendly questions lead to more replies and conversations that actually go somewhere on Mingle2.
